Connecting Directly To Laptop or PC
In a typical scenario cameras are connected using network cables to a
network switch. A camera can also be connected to a PC or laptop
directly. Be sure to use a cross-over network cable between the camera
and PC when connecting in this fashion.
When a camera is connected directly, in some cases you may need to
change TCP/IP configuration on your PC. For example, configure the PC to
work with a static IP address.
When a PoE injector is used and connected directly to a PC there are two
networking cables, one cable connects the PC to the PoE injector; the
other connects the injector to the camera. Only one of these cables must
be cross-over. The other cable must be regular, not cross-over.
Note:
MP8D cameras require a higher PoE power class (Class 3: from 6.49 to 12.95 Watt) than
other MP camera models.
Switches and Routers
Note that some Gigabit switches and network adapters incompletely
emulate 100BaseT signaling levels and may not work correctly with high
bandwidth 100BaseT equipment.
Low Sharpness
If the image sharpness appears to be low:
• Check if the lens is in focus.
• Check if the lens is appropriate for a mega-pixel camera.
• Under Image Quality menu decrease compression and increase
sharpness.
• Check if the lens iris is fully open or closed down too much. For best
resolution and depth of field the iris (depending on lens make and
model) should be closed by 2-3 F-stops.
